\sqrt{\left(\left(\frac{\left(a + b\right) + c}{2} \cdot \left(\frac{\left(a + b\right) + c}{2} - a\right)\right) \cdot \left(\frac{\left(a + b\right) + c}{2} - b\right)\right) \cdot \left(\frac{\left(a + b\right) + c}{2} - c\right)}double f(double a, double b, double c) {
double r62450 = a;
double r62451 = b;
double r62452 = r62450 + r62451;
double r62453 = c;
double r62454 = r62452 + r62453;
double r62455 = 2.0;
double r62456 = r62454 / r62455;
double r62457 = r62456 - r62450;
double r62458 = r62456 * r62457;
double r62459 = r62456 - r62451;
double r62460 = r62458 * r62459;
double r62461 = r62456 - r62453;
double r62462 = r62460 * r62461;
double r62463 = sqrt(r62462);
return r62463;
}